SOURCE: Turn Signal Clicking doesn't stop on my 03 Alero

you need to replace the multifuntion switch (sigal/headlight/wiper switch)
1 disconnect the battery
2 remove the steering column covers 3 bolts on the bottom should be 7mm
3 seperate the cover (2 piece)
4 remove the screw in the centre of the multifuntion switch (25 or 30 torx)
5 remove the wiring connections
INSTALLING
1 reconnect wiring connections
2 install new switch (push in the HORN CONTACT ) make sure switch seats in flush
3 install torx screw
4 install the steering column covers
5 reconnect battery

SOURCE: I own a 2004 olds alero, sometimes my turn signals

Most likely it is the switch, But first try replacing the flasher ( they are around $10.00) which is alot cheaper than the switch is. When your flashers are working listen for the clicking and feel around under the dash ( it is the easiest way to find it) give that a try. make sure you are using the turn signal and not the hazard flasher (they both have there own flasher)

I got a 2002 ford taurus and when i go to turn my headlights on the interior light dont work and the blinkers light up but they do blink when im turning, i was what it could be thats causing that thank...

Many turn signal lamps will have multiple bulbs in them. If "one" of the bulbs is faulty, the interior lamp or lamps will come on, indicating a bad bulb. You will need to turn on your left blinker and view the bulb and make sure all bulbs appear to be blinking on front and rear of the car, then repeat with the right blinker. If you find one that doesn't appear to look right or blinks faster slower or dimmer, then replace the bulbs in that turn signal. The interior light may begin working properly when you replace the "shorted" bulb for the turn signals. If it does not, check the fuses to make sure the "shorted" bulb didn't damage your fuse for the interior lights.

Problems

Generally means that a bulb is out.
When a bulb blows, then the blinker has less electrical resistance, so the blinker works at a faster pace.
Have someone in the car as you inspect all lights.
.... and! As long as you have an assistant, check the headlights, stop lights, license plate light, brake lights, emergency flashers ....
